
Solpower Company Limited successfully executed a 216kWp solar energy project for NP Gandour, a regional leader in personal care and pharmaceutical products. The project was carried out across two strategic sites—Accra, Ghana (36kWp) and Togo (180kWp)—aimed at cutting energy costs and supporting the company’s environmental sustainability goals.
Solpower provided full turnkey solutions for both sites, which included:
- Energy audits and site-specific system design
- Supply and installation of Tier-1 monocrystalline solar panels
- Deployment of high-efficiency string inverters with smart monitoring
- Custom-engineered rooftop mounting systems
- Electrical integration with facility operations
- System testing, commissioning, and staff training


System Overview
Total Capacity: 216kWp
Accra, Ghana: 36kWp
Togo: 180kWp
Annual Energy Yield: ~324,000 kWh combined
CO₂ Offset: Approx. 162 metric tons per year
Remote monitoring systems allow for real-time performance tracking and optimization
